Emergency
An emergency is an unexpected, often urgent situation requiring immediate action to prevent harm, loss, or escalation. Emergencies span contexts from individual cardiac events and structural fires to large-scale incidents like the 2010 Haiti earthquake and the Chernobyl disaster, intersecting with institutions such as the United Nations and the International Red Cross and Red Crescent Movement. Responses involve actors including the Federal Emergency Management Agency, the World Health Organization, and local agencies such as the New York City Police Department or the London Fire Brigade.
An emergency is characterized by timing, severity, and the need for rapid mobilization. Types include medical emergencies (e.g., myocardial infarction, cerebrovascular accident), technological incidents (e.g., Deepwater Horizon oil spill, Fukushima Daiichi nuclear disaster), natural hazards (e.g., Hurricane Katrina, Mount St. Helens eruption), and human-made crises (e.g., September 11 attacks, Bhopal disaster). Other categories comprise public order crises like the Arab Spring protests and infrastructure failures such as the Northeast blackout of 2003.
Causes vary by type and scale. Natural hazards stem from geophysical and meteorological processes exemplified by the Indian Ocean earthquake and tsunami and Typhoon Haiyan. Technological and industrial emergencies often arise from cascade failures as in the Flixborough disaster or regulatory lapses highlighted after the Deepwater Horizon oil spill. Public health emergencies may originate from emerging pathogens like SARS-CoV-2, vectors implicated in Zika transmission, or antibiotic resistance traced in studies linked to MRSA. Socio-political risks include conflict events such as the Syrian civil war and economic shocks traced to crises like the 2008 financial crisis.
Emergency response systems coordinate actors and resources. Incident command models such as the Incident Command System structure multi-agency efforts during events like Hurricane Sandy. National authorities—Federal Emergency Management Agency, Public Health England, ANSES—work with international bodies including the World Health Organization, International Federation of Red Cross and Red Crescent Societies, and the European Civil Protection Mechanism. First responders include Emergency medical services, Fire departments, and law enforcement entities like the Royal Canadian Mounted Police. Logistics and communications leverage standards from organizations such as ISO and platforms used in crises like the 2011 Tōhoku earthquake and tsunami.
Medical emergencies require triage, stabilization, and definitive care. Clinical protocols such as Advanced Cardiac Life Support and Pediatric Advanced Life Support derive from guidelines by the American Heart Association and the European Resuscitation Council. Prehospital care systems exemplified by London Ambulance Service and Boston Emergency Medical Services implement triage algorithms used in mass-casualty incidents like the Manchester Arena bombing. Hospital surge capacity planning references hospitals such as Johns Hopkins Hospital and Massachusetts General Hospital, while public health surveillance systems like those of the Centers for Disease Control and Prevention monitor outbreaks exemplified by Ebola.
Public health emergencies integrate epidemiology, emergency management, and humanitarian response. Responses to pandemics involve institutions such as the World Health Organization, national centers like the Centers for Disease Control and Prevention, and initiatives by Médecins Sans Frontières. Disaster relief operations coordinate logistics from hub cities such as Port-au-Prince after the 2010 Haiti earthquake and utilize frameworks like the Sendai Framework for Disaster Risk Reduction. Vaccination campaigns, water, sanitation, and shelter programs reference tools developed by UNICEF and the World Food Programme.
Legal frameworks govern declarations, powers, and limits during crises. Statutes and instruments include emergency powers under national constitutions, international law principles such as those in the Geneva Conventions, and public health statutes applied during outbreaks like SARS and H1N1. Ethical dilemmas involve resource allocation exemplified in triage debates in Italy during the COVID-19 pandemic, privacy tensions seen with contact tracing systems influenced by rulings in bodies like the European Court of Human Rights, and obligations of humanitarian actors guided by the Sphere Handbook.
Preparedness combines hazard assessment, planning, and capacity building. Risk reduction efforts reference the Sendai Framework for Disaster Risk Reduction, urban resilience projects in cities like Tokyo and San Francisco, and climate adaptation strategies discussed in reports by the Intergovernmental Panel on Climate Change. Training, exercises, and community engagement draw on curricula from institutions such as the National Preparedness Leadership Initiative and simulation programs used by the World Health Organization and the Red Cross. Mitigation includes infrastructure retrofitting as seen after the Great Hanshin earthquake and policy reforms following incidents like the Flint water crisis.
